For less money than a Gold Class PVR ticket, you can purchase a gold standard DVD on GNB-Isai Vaseekaran. After spending some hours with the remarkable young man Lalitharam, who has authored books on GNB and researched and put together this DVD, I bought it online in Kalakendra/Swati.
What a remarkable documentary. The narrative, the music, the encomiums, the quotes, the photos and cine clips, and more than anything else, the suffusion of an inexpressible richness or grandeur throughout, makes this DVD a worthy example of Carnatic music's tribute, nay hero worship, of GNB, a one-man epoch in the 20th century.
There are many many touching moments, rare musical insights, and lovely narratives (what a presenter this Madhuvanthi Arun is!)
I was deeply touched to hear the tribute shloka by S Kalyanaraman, the Kaanada line "marALa jayita" from GNB's composition Paranmukhamelanamma- sung at the promoting of Paramacharya- by Trichur Ramachandran...the Hindolam sung by an unwell GNB in his very last days at home to the request of overseas fans...
The "Vasudeva Eni" in that remarkable 8 minute gramophone plate, and so on and so forth. Ragas Gavati, Andolika....
